Remove Duplicate Lines
Instantly remove repeated lines from any block of text.
The Remove Duplicate Lines tool scans your text and deletes repeated lines, keeping only unique entries. It is ideal for cleaning up lists, log files, and data exports where duplicates creep in. Paste your text and get a clean, deduplicated result instantly.
What This Tool Does
Duplicate lines waste space and cause confusion. Whether you have a list of names with repeats, a log file with redundant entries, or a CSV export with duplicate rows, this tool strips them out. You can choose case-sensitive or case-insensitive matching, and the tool preserves the original order of your lines. It handles thousands of lines without slowing down, making it practical for real-world data cleaning tasks that would take ages to do manually.
Why Use This Tool
Duplicates waste time and cause confusion. In mailing lists, they mean sending the same message twice. In data analysis, they skew results. In reports, they make content look sloppy. Finding duplicates manually in a long list is impractical - you might miss some, and it takes far too long. This tool gives you a clean, deduplicated list in under a second, no matter how large your text is. It is the fastest way to ensure every line in your data appears exactly once.
How to Use
- Paste your text with duplicate lines into the input box, or upload a file.
- Choose whether to match duplicates case-sensitively or not.
- Click Remove Duplicates to process.
- Copy the deduplicated result or download it.
Common Use Cases
- Cleaning up mailing lists with repeated email addresses
- Removing duplicate entries from CSV exports
- Deduplicating log file entries for analysis
- Cleaning keyword lists for SEO or advertising
- Removing repeated items from to-do lists or inventories
Example
Tips
- Use case-insensitive mode when working with names or text that may vary in capitalization
- Sort your list after deduplication using the Text Sorter for an organized result
- Combine with Trim Text to catch duplicates hidden by leading or trailing whitespace
Frequently Asked Questions
Is this tool free?
Yes. It is completely free with no limits on how many lines you can process.
Does it preserve the order of lines?
Yes. The tool keeps the first occurrence of each line and removes subsequent duplicates, so your original order is maintained.
Is matching case-sensitive?
By default, yes. You can toggle case-insensitive mode so that "Apple" and "apple" are treated as the same line.
Can I use this on large files?
Yes. The tool processes text entirely in your browser and handles thousands of lines efficiently.
Is my data private?
Absolutely. Everything runs locally in your browser. No data is uploaded or stored on any server.